CC -!- FUNCTION: Forms part of the ribosomal stalk, playing a central role in
CC the interaction of the ribosome with GTP-bound translation factors.
CC {ECO:0000256|HAMAP-Rule:MF_00280}.
CC -!- SUBUNIT: Part of the 50S ribosomal subunit. Forms part of the ribosomal
CC stalk which helps the ribosome interact with GTP-bound translation
CC factors. Forms a heptameric L10(L12)2(L12)2(L12)2 complex, where L10
CC forms an elongated spine to which the L12 dimers bind in a sequential
CC fashion. {ECO:0000256|HAMAP-Rule:MF_00280}.
CC -!- SIMILARITY: Belongs to the universal ribosomal protein uL10 family.
CC {ECO:0000256|ARBA:ARBA00008889, ECO:0000256|HAMAP-Rule:MF_00280}.
